What is the Level 3 Award in Assessing Vocationally Related Achievement?
The Level 3 Award in Assessing Vocationally Related Achievement is a professional qualification aimed at individuals who assess vocational skills, knowledge, and understanding in environments such as workplaces, training centers, or educational institutions. It is part of the broader suite of qualifications for assessors and verifiers, ensuring that vocational assessments are conducted to the highest standards.

Why Pursue This Qualification?
Obtaining the Level 3 Award in Assessing Vocationally Related Achievement offers numerous benefits:
- Career Advancement: This qualification is highly valued by employers, opening doors to roles such as vocational assessor, trainer, or quality assurance officer.
- Professional Recognition: It demonstrates your commitment to maintaining high standards in vocational assessment.
- Skill Development: You’ll gain practical skills in planning, delivering, and evaluating assessments, ensuring they are fair, valid, and reliable.
